Hazrat As‘ad bin Yazid(ra)

A Badri Companion of the Holy Prophet(sa)

(Friday Sermon - February 8, 2019 )

Background and Participation in Battles

Hazrat As‘ad’s(ra) father was Yazid bin al-Fakih and he belonged to the branch of Banu Zuraiq of the Ansar tribe of Khazraj. He participated alongside the Holy Prophet(sa) in the battles of Badr and Uhud. Allama ibn Ishaq has recorded the name of Sa‘d bin Yazid, instead of As‘ad among the companions of Badr. There are various opinions regarding the name of As‘ad bin Yazid. Some have stated the following names: Sa‘d bin Zaid, Sa‘id bin al-Fakih and Sa‘d bin Yazid. (Al-Tabaqaat-ul-Kubra, Vol. 3, p. 445, As’ad bin Yazid(ra), Dar-ul-Kutub Al-Ilmiyyah, Beirut, 1990) (Usdul Ghaba, Vol. 2, p. 450, Sa’d bin al-Fakih(ra), Dar-ul-Kutub Al-Ilmiyyah, Beirut, 2003)
